Thought For the Day: She Plucked From My Lapel the Invisible Strand of Lint (the Universal Act of Woman To Proclaim Ownership)
“She plucked from my lapel the invisible strand of lint (the universal act of woman to proclaim ownership).” -O. Henry, short-story writer (11 Sep 1862-1910)

Thought For the Day: The Real Rulers In Washington Are Invisible and Exercise Power From Behind the Scenes
“The real rulers in Washington are invisible and exercise power from behind the scenes.” – Justice Felix Frankfurter (1882-1965)

Thought For the Day: Nothing Is So Invisible As An Unpleasant Truth
“To most of us nothing is so invisible as an unpleasant truth. Though it is held before our eyes, pushed under our noses, rammed down our throats — we know it not.” – Eric Hoffer (1902-1983)
